Designed by Populous, Silverstone Race Circuit is located in Northamptonshire, United Kingdom. The new look Silverstone race circuit in Northamptonshire was unveiled Thursday by HRH the Duke of York. The track, designed by the global architectural design practice Populous, includes six new corners and now totals 3.66 miles in length.
